Why Does Preserved Lemon Change the Taste Experience?

Preserved lemon defines much of Moroccan cooking. Salt-cured lemons ferment slowly, softening bitterness and intensifying citrus oils. In this harissa, preserved lemon provides rounded acidity instead of sharp sourness. It blends with olive oil to form a savory citrus backbone.

How Does Olive Oil Enhance Stability and Taste?

Extra virgin olive oil acts as both flavor carrier and protective layer. It dissolves fat-soluble spice compounds, increasing aroma during cooking. It also reduces oxidation of chili particles.

What Role Do the Traditional Spices Play?

Cumin adds warmth and slight bitterness. Caraway contributes earthy sharpness. Coriander introduces citrus lift. Garlic deepens savory tones. Mint softens the finish. Each spice plays a specific structural role.
